History will remember the school year 2005-2006 for all the fundamental changes we collectively achieved.

We’ve won in various fronts including issues on liberalizing the dress code and the attendance policy. We were able to maximize student representation in the student discipline process by giving access to free legal consultation provided by the Free Legal Assistance Group (FLAG). We continue to push for legislation that will pave the way for a National Students’ Code, one that protects the rights of all students wherever they may be. We have incessantly engaged in the fight for credible leadership and good governance in order to push for lasting and meaningful changes for our country. Overall, we lead key initiatives not just in issue advocacy but also in nation-building.

A heightened student governance, successfully lobbying for more liberal university policies coupled with the manifestation of a strong, vigilant and an action-oriented citizenry, proves that Lasallians are indeed ready to take it to the next level.
